Discuss two of the governments anti corruption strategies that attempts to deal with corruption as a whole

If this pertain to South Africa, their government established a toll free number wherein any individual can report corruption anonymously. Aside from this, the government established strict protocols in each departments to deter people from committing corruption. There are also unannounced checks being done to its departments to ensure that if corruption practices are being done, the culpable people will be caught red-handed.

There are also independent agencies whose tasks is to investigate any reported corrupt practices like SAPS, SUI, etc.
